The Alps and the Himalayas are arguably the two most famous mountain ranges on Earth, yet they differ dramatically in scale, age, and character. The Alps stretch 1,200 kilometers across central Europe with a highest point of 4,809 meters at Mont Blanc. The Himalayas extend 2,400 kilometers across South Asia and contain all 14 of the world's peaks above 8,000 meters.
Introduction
Both ranges were formed by tectonic collision, but at vastly different times and scales. The Alps arose from the convergence of the African and European plates roughly 65 million years ago, while the Himalayas began forming when the Indian plate crashed into the Eurasian plate about 50 million years ago and continue to rise today.
Size & Geography
- Alps Length: ~1,200 km
- Himalayas Length: ~2,400 km
- Alps Highest Peak: Mont Blanc, 4,809 m
- Himalayas Highest Peak: Mount Everest, 8,849 m
- Alps Area: ~200,000 km²
- Himalayas Area: ~595,000 km²
The Himalayas are roughly twice as long, three times the area, and nearly twice the maximum elevation of the Alps. The Himalayan range includes the Tibetan Plateau to its north, the highest and largest plateau on Earth, earning the region its nickname "the Roof of the World."
The Alps are more compact and accessible, divided among eight countries: France, Switzerland, Italy, Austria, Germany, Liechtenstein, Slovenia, and Monaco. Despite their smaller size, the Alps contain enormous geographic diversity, from Mediterranean-influenced valleys in the south to heavily glaciated peaks in the center.
Alps Profile
- Countries: 8
- Glaciers: ~3,000 (rapidly shrinking)
- Population in Alps: ~14 million
- Tourism: ~120 million visitors per year
The Alps are the most densely populated mountain range in the world, with major cities like Innsbruck, Zurich, and Grenoble nestled in their valleys. Europe's road and rail networks cross the Alps through famous passes like the Brenner and Gotthard, and through engineering marvels like the Gotthard Base Tunnel, the world's longest railway tunnel at 57 kilometers.
Alpine glaciers, while still impressive, are retreating rapidly due to climate change. The range has lost approximately half its glacier volume since 1900. The Alps are the birthplace of modern mountaineering and skiing, and their tourism industry generates over $50 billion annually. Iconic peaks like the Matterhorn and Mont Blanc are among the most recognized mountains in the world.
Himalayas Profile
- Countries: 5 (India, Nepal, Bhutan, China, Pakistan)
- Peaks Above 8,000 m: All 14 on Earth
- Glaciers: ~15,000
- Rivers Fed: Ganges, Indus, Brahmaputra, Yangtze, Mekong
The Himalayas are the source of Asia's greatest rivers, providing water to over 1.5 billion people. The glaciers of the Himalayas, sometimes called the "Third Pole," hold the largest store of freshwater ice outside the polar regions. These glaciers feed the Ganges, Indus, Brahmaputra, and other rivers that sustain agriculture and civilization across South Asia.
The Himalayan range is home to extraordinary biodiversity, from tropical forests at its base to arctic conditions at its peaks. Iconic species include the snow leopard, red panda, Himalayan tahr, and numerous endemic plants. The region also holds immense spiritual significance as the mythical home of the gods in Hindu, Buddhist, and Bon traditions.
Key Differences
- Age: Alps ~65 MY; Himalayas ~50 MY
- Maximum Elevation: Alps 4,809 m; Himalayas 8,849 m
- Accessibility: Alps highly accessible; Himalayas remote
- Population Density: Alps densely settled; Himalayas sparsely populated
The most striking difference is scale. The Himalayas contain peaks that tower nearly 4,000 meters above the highest point in the Alps. The treeline in the Himalayas sits at roughly 4,000 meters, nearly at the summit of Mont Blanc. Altitude sickness, which rarely affects Alps visitors, is a constant concern above 3,000 meters in the Himalayas.
Accessibility is another key contrast. Alpine valleys have been major trade routes for millennia, with modern highways and railways crossing the range. Much of the Himalayas remains accessible only on foot, with some communities requiring days of trekking to reach. This isolation has preserved traditional cultures but also limited development.

Key Facts
- The Himalayas are roughly twice as long and twice as high as the Alps.
- All 14 peaks above 8,000 m are in the Himalayas; the Alps' highest is 4,809 m.
- The Alps receive ~120 million tourists annually, making them the world's most visited mountains.
- Himalayan glaciers supply water to over 1.5 billion people in South Asia.
- Both ranges are still tectonically active and continue to rise.
Fun Facts
- The Gotthard Base Tunnel through the Alps is 57 km long, the world's longest railway tunnel.
- Mount Everest's summit was once at the bottom of the Tethys Sea, containing marine fossils.
- The Alps lose about 3% of their glacier volume every year due to climate change.
- Bhutan, entirely within the Himalayas, measures national success by Gross National Happiness.
